Small-leaved mint, scientifically known as Mentha microphylla, is a medicinal herb prized for its refreshing aroma and therapeutic properties. It is commonly used as an adaptogen to help the body manage stress and enhance resilience. The plant is rich in menthol and other essential oils, offering primary benefits such as soothing respiratory issues, aiding digestion, and promoting mental clarity. Traditionally, it has been used in herbal medicine across various cultures to treat ailments like headaches, colds, and digestive discomfort. In modern wellness, it is valued for its role in aromatherapy, herbal teas, and natural remedies, with its unique, subtle flavor making it a sought-after spice in culinary applications.
